Short DescriptionResponsible for
Facilitating the medical staff Ongoing Professional Practice Evaluation (OPPE) and Focused Professional Practice Evaluation (FPPE) functions in accordance with The Joint Commission Standards, CMS Conditions of Participation, National Committee on Quality Assurance, and other regulatory requirements.Ensure that clinical reviews are timely, effective and appropriately documented. Responsible for the delineation of clinical privilege management.Collaborate with the Department Chief and/or Division Head to solicit updates/modifications to existing delineations to ensure privilege forms remain current, reflect clinical practice, and are consistent with industry standards.For new privileges, the Quality and Privileging Analyst will compile information relevant to the privileges requested which may include appropriate privilege criteria, position and opinion papers from specialty organizations, white papers from the Credentialing Resource Center and documentation from other health systems, as appropriate.Responsible for facilitating the provider change in privileges credentialing process. Collaborate with providers and clinical departments to complete modifications in provider privileges regarding the addition of new privileges, department transfers and/or change in Medical Staff category/status.#LI-CU1
